Delasport is a leading iGaming software developer that delivers a one-stop-shop solution for sports betting, online casino, and player account management. Our platform is player-centric and focuses on personalization and cutting-edge technological innovations.
Since its founding in 2010, Delasport has won multiple international awards and has gained a proven track record of excellence, stability, and overall success. Yet, this only motivates us to reach higher and higher.
Currently, Delasport is proud to have over 400 experts in various IT and business fields and several offices: in Bulgaria (Sofia and Plovdiv), Ukraine and Malta.
YOUR RESPONSIBILITIES:
- Build and support Node.js applications that are part of our Sportsbook platform
- Integration of user-facing elements developed by front-end developers with server-side logic
- Write reusable, testable and efficient code
- Design and implement low-latency, high-availability, performant applications
- Integrate data storage solutions such as databases, key-value stores, blob stores, etc.
- Write unit and integration tests
- Complete two weeks sprints and participate in sprint retrospectives and daily standups
- Assist with estimating and planning upcoming work
REQUIREMENTS:
- 3+ years working with Node.js for server-side development (Middle position)
- 5+ years working with Node.js for server-side development (Senior position)
- Proficiency in JavaScript (TypeScript)
- Thorough understanding of REST APIs and GraphQL
- Knowledge in both SQL and NoSQL databases (MySQL, MongoDB, Postgres)
- Experience working with containers (Docker, k8s)
- Habits in writing unit/integration tests
- Strong knowledge in Git, branching strategies
- Hands-on experience with message brokers, Kafka, AMQP
- Hands-on experience with Microservices in SOA
- Additional background with PHP and Websockets will be considered an advantage
OUR REWARD TO YOU IS:
- Competitive salary package
- 20+ vacation days
- Travel allowance
- Food vouchers
- Birthday vouchers
- Newborn vouchers
- Health Insurance
- Multisport card
- Friendly work environment with positive teammates
- Friday Happy hour filled with free drinks and snacks
- Courses and certifications budget
- Team-building activities
- Great office location
#LI-HYBRID